How much do remote training jobs pay per hour?

As of May 28,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ote training in The Bronx, NY is $43.97,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$29.04 and $56.11 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Trainer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Trainer, you need expertise in instructional design, subject matter proficiency, and experience in adult learning principles, often supported by a relevant degree or training certification. Familiarity with virtual learning platforms (e.g., Zoom, Microsoft Teams, LMS like Moodle) and digital content creation tools is typically required. Strong communication, adaptability, and engagement skills help connect with diverse learners and manage remote sessions effectively. These skills ensure that training is accessible, interactive, and impactful for participants in a virtual environment.

What are some common challenges faced by professionals in remote training roles, and how can they be addressed?

Professionals in remote training roles often encounter challenges such as maintaining participant engagement, managing different time zones, and ensuring clear communication without face-to-face interaction. To address these, trainers can utilize interactive tools like polls and breakout rooms, schedule sessions at mutually convenient times, and provide clear, concise instructions. Building rapport through regular check-ins and feedback also helps foster a collaborative virtual learning environment.

What is remote training?

Remote training refers to educational or instructional sessions that are delivered virtually, allowing participants to learn from any location via the internet. This type of training typically uses video conferencing tools, online learning platforms, and digital resources to facilitate teaching and collaboration. Remote training is popular for its flexibility and ability to connect trainees and trainers who may be geographically dispersed. It is commonly used for employee onboarding, skill development, and professional certifications in various industries.
